I visited Universal Studios Hollywood during a long layover in Los Angeles, so I had only a few hours to make the most of the park. Buying the Express Pass through Headout turned out to be the best decision of the day. Wait times ranged from about 20 to 100 minutes, and without it, I simply would not have been able to experience so much in such limited time. Super Nintendo World was pure magic. It doesn’t just feel like a themed area—it genuinely feels like stepping inside the video game and becoming part of it. The biggest surprise came when I got the chance to experience the soft opening of the new Fast & Furious roller coaster. Absolutely incredible! I love roller coasters, and this was hands down the best one I’ve ever ridden. The Spanish Studio Tour was another unexpected highlight: funny, fascinating and educational. Seeing the sets and discovering how movies and special effects are created made it one of the most memorable experiences of my visit. Minions and Kung Fu Panda were also wonderfully immersive. Despite the crowds, the park was spotless, the staff were consistently friendly, the signage was clear, and the stores had an amazing variety of souvenirs. A few tips for future visitors: wear very comfortable shoes, check the weather before choosing your clothes, and expect crowds and lines, including for food. There weren’t as many places to sit and rest as I expected. I was lucky to have a beautiful sunny 24°C day, which was perfect for exploring. I arrived thinking Universal would simply be a fun way to spend my layover. I left feeling that my layover had become one of the highlights of my entire trip. If your time is limited, plan ahead—and the Express Pass is worth every minute it saves.

    • Enjoy full-day access to Universal Studios Hollywood, including all rides, attractions, live shows, and events.

    • Take the world-famous Studio Tour and go behind the scenes of real movie sets and soundstages.

    • Experience thrilling rides like Jurassic World – The Ride, Transformers™: The Ride-3D, The Secret Life of Pets: Off the Leash, and attractions like The Wizarding World of Harry Potter™, and more.

    • Catch action-packed live shows like WaterWorld and special character meet-and-greets throughout the park.

    • Pick a 1-day or 2-day pass, or take advantage of the buy-one-get-one free offer. Add an Express Pass to your 1-day ticket for priority access to popular rides and save 1-4 hours waiting in lines.
